My mom has had her JCP CC for over 10 years, free of baddies. Today, she added me as an authorized user. Im a little confused though. Will it report to my credit as a new account or will it report her full 10 year history? My AAoA is about 2 years so im hoping it would boost it up.
Thanks!
It will report history starting the month you became AU but you will inherit the age of the account for AAoA purposes

It's only been two weeks. It might well take up to two months for it to begin to appear on your reports.
On the plus side, the AU account will help you with more than AAoA (Average age of accounts). It will also help you with Age of Oldest Account. That's a different factor. How old is your oldest account right now?

You'll get a real nice boost to your Age of Oldest Account when it appears. From 3 to 10. Do you know when your Mom's last statement date was for the JC Penney card?
A completely reasonable guess is that JCP might have taken a couple weeks to do the housekeeping on its end. (E.g. end of Sept.) Then they might not have reported it till the next time the statement printed. (Oct 23 or perhaps a few days after.) And then it might take another week or two for the CRAs to update their databases.
So giving it another week would be very reasonable, maybe even a bit more. Do you have a tool that enables you to pull your credit reports as often as ince a week? If not, Credit Karma is a good choice and it is free. It will enable you to check once a week to see if the account has appeared yet.
